  • A gate driver with Boot-strap chain is proposed to drive Multi-level PDP sustain switches. The proposed gate driver uses only one boot-strap capacitor and one diode per each MOSFETs switch without floating power supply. By adoption of this gate driver circuits, the size, weight and the cost of the drivel board can be reduced.

  • We evaluate the link-level performance of cooperative multi-hop relaying networks with an maximum distance separable (MDS) code. The effect of the code on the link-level performance at the destination is investigated in terms of the outage probability and the spectral efficiency. Assuming a simple topology, we construct an absorbing Markov chain. Numerical results indicate that significant improvement can be achieved by incorporating an MDS code. MDS codes successfully facilitate recovery of the message block at a relaying node due to powerful error-correcting capability, so that it can reduce the outage probability. Furthermore, we evaluate the average number of hops where the message block can be delivered.

  • Singh's multi-level method is extended to the optimal tracking control of a large interconnected dynamical system which has coupled states and coupled inputs. The steady-state tracking error and a convergence condition for the extended multi-level method are derived analytically and the results show that the steady-state tracking error and a convergence rate have to be compromised. Also, a new multi-level method which is advantageous over the Singh's method in steady-state tracking error and computational burden is proposed by introducing nominal inputs into the performance index. The resulting feedback gain matrix and the compensation vector are optimal for all initial conditions so that eventual on-line computation is minimal.

  • Energy recovery in the regenerative region is very important when SRM(Switched Reluctance Motor) is used in traction drive. This is because that to reduce energy toss during mechanical breaking and/or to have a high efficiency drive during breaking. To control excitation voltage in motor operation and regenerative voltage in the generator operation in the SRM, multi-level voltage control is effective. This paper proposes multi-level inverter which is useful for motoring and regenerative operation in SRM. The proposed method is verified by experiment.

  • In this paper, we proposed the isolated multi-level inverter using 3-phase transformers. It makes possible to use a single DC power source due to employing low frequency transformers. In this inverter, the number of transformer could be reduced comparing with an exiting 3-phase multi-level inverter using single phase transformer. Also, using phase angle control method with switching frequency equal to output fundamental frequency, harmonics component of output voltage and switching losses can be reduced. Finally, we made a prototype inverter to clarify the proposed electric circuit and reasonableness of control signal.
